Banish that Bad Backgammon Attitude

Want to be seen as a gambling player with a bad attitude in the backgammon scene? Surely you would not want that. Other than you will have a bad reputation, other gambling players will not take it easy on you and winning will be a lot harder for you that way. If you do not want to end up as the least liked gambling player, then avoid doing these things while playing backgammon:

- Each time the other gambling player casts a poor roll, appearing to be very excited and glad. Your opponent already knows that you were glad he was unlucky with the roll, there is no need to make it any more obvious. So, be a little more considerate and keep your celebration to yourself. Everybody loves the modest gambling player.

- Eating food in an untidy way, maybe eating something with sauce or gravy at the backgammon game. The sauce may drip on the game pieces and the game board itself, which is a major turn-off for any decent gambling player. Try not to eat while playing. But if you really need to grab a bite, go for something that will not mess up the game, literally.

- Making the move for your opponent. It is a mark of every gambling player to make his opponent move in a way that would benefit him, not the opponent. If in any point you succeed in doing this, for example, you gave no other option for your opponent, then you are a good gambling player. But, it will be all put in to waste if you make such a big deal out of it, by emphasizing what you have done. Even if it is the only move he can make, do not move his markers. He has his own hands. Leave him an ounce of dignity.

- Yelling at the top of your lungs that you have won the game. We know that you are happy you won, but you should be sensitive about the other gambling player's pride. After all, if you think you are really good, you do not need to shout it out to the whole world. Just win more games and people will notice you. It is always better to be discovered to be good at something instead of proclaiming that you are and in the end be proven that you really are not good. Backgammon is not a popularity contest. It's a game of skills.
